Description If you're looking to build your career in accounting, there's currently a long-term contract Staff Accountant position with Robert Half that you may want to check out. As a Staff Accountant, you will prepare journal entries, monthly and year-end closings, bank reconciliation, fixed asset maintenance and general ledger reconciliation. During the monthly close, many aspects of internal reporting will be your responsibility. You will assist in developing and implementing accounting policies. In addition, you will participate in compliance, review schedules for the reporting processes, and work alongside our external auditors for quarterly reviews and annual audits. This very involved position works to produce Cash Flow projections, Budgets, and Financial Statements. Based in the Mt.
